Title | 一种适用于多精度计算的可重构浮点乘加运算单元及方法 |
Author | |
First Inventor | 谢歆昂
|
Original applicant | 南方科技大学
|
First applicant | 南方科技大学
|
Address of First applicant | 518055 广东省深圳市南山区学苑大道1088号南方科技大学
|
Current applicant | 南方科技大学
|
Address of Current applicant | 518055 广东省深圳市南山区学苑大道1088号南方科技大学 (广东,深圳,南山区)
|
First Current Applicant | 南方科技大学
|
Address of First Current Applicant | 518055 广东省深圳市南山区学苑大道1088号南方科技大学 (广东,深圳,南山区)
|
Application Number | CN202110178984.2
|
Application Date | 2021-02-09
|
Open (Notice) Number | CN112860220B
|
Date Available | 2023-03-24
|
Publication Years | 2023-03-24
|
Status of Patent | 授权
|
Legal Date | 2023-03-24
|
Subtype | 授权发明
|
SUSTech Authorship | First
|
Abstract | 本发明公开了一种适用于多精度计算的可重构浮点乘加运算单元及方法,通过采用统一的方法对不同精度的浮点的尾数进行划分,得到多个比特段,并调用不同数量的同一类单元乘法器在一个周期内实现多个比特段的乘法运算并输出对应的乘积,然后对所述乘积进行移位相加操作后即可得到浮点数的乘累加运算结果。本发明采用统一的尾数划分方案避免了比特冗余的问题,采用统一的单元乘法器提高了硬件利用率,还可以实现半精度浮点数的乘累加运算、单精度点积浮点数的乘累加运算和双精度浮点数的乘累加运算。解决了现有技术中支持多精度浮点乘法运算的运算方法会产生比特冗余、硬件利用率低等情况的问题。 |
Other Abstract | 本发明公开了一种适用于多精度计算的可重构浮点乘加运算单元及方法,通过采用统一的方法对不同精度的浮点的尾数进行划分,得到多个比特段,并调用不同数量的同一类单元乘法器在一个周期内实现多个比特段的乘法运算并输出对应的乘积,然后对所述乘积进行移位相加操作后即可得到浮点数的乘累加运算结果。本发明采用统一的尾数划分方案避免了比特冗余的问题,采用统一的单元乘法器提高了硬件利用率,还可以实现半精度浮点数的乘累加运算、单精度点积浮点数的乘累加运算和双精度浮点数的乘累加运算。解决了现有技术中支持多精度浮点乘法运算的运算方法会产生比特冗余、硬件利用率低等情况的问题。 |
IPC Classification Number | G06F7/575
; G06F7/523
|
INPADOC Legal Status | (+PATENT GRANT)[2023-03-24][CN]
|
INPADOC Patent Family Count | 2
|
Extended Patent Family Count | 2
|
Priority date | 2021-02-09
|
Patent Agent | 徐凯凯
; 谢松
|
Agency | 深圳市君胜知识产权代理事务所(普通合伙)
|
URL | [Source Record] |
Data Source | PatSnap
|
Document Type | Patent |
Identifier | http://kc.sustech.edu.cn/handle/2SGJ60CL/522609 |
Department | Preparatory Office of SUSTech Institute of Microelectronics, SUSTech and HKUST 工学院_深港微电子学院 |
Recommended Citation GB/T 7714 |
谢歆昂,李凯,李博宇,等. 一种适用于多精度计算的可重构浮点乘加运算单元及方法[P]. 2023-03-24.
|
Files in This Item: | There are no files associated with this item. |
|
Items in the repository are protected by copyright, with all rights reserved, unless otherwise indicated.
Edit Comment